Technical Notes & Considerations
-
The OLED display offers deep blacks and high contrast, but may have slightly different longevity or brightness trade-offs compared to IPS panels
-
Because many OmniBook Ultra models use soldered memory, RAM may not be user-upgradable — check the exact SKU
-
Heat management in thin convertible designs is always a trade-off — under sustained workloads, expect elevated thermal and fan noise
-
Battery life under light tasks may be strong, but taxing work (e.g., rendering, video editing) will shorten runtime
-
Make sure the included power adapter wattage is sufficient to support full performance + charging
-
Firmware/drivers (especially GPU / display) should stay up to date for best stability and performance
-
Check region-specific variations: some SKUs may have different display refresh rates, port configurations, or security options
